Db2

DBPATH、LOGPATH 和 STORAGEPATH

  • September 12, 2016

假設只有兩個可用路徑,例如 /log 和 /data。將 DBPATH 設置為 /log 或 /data 會更好嗎?IE

CREATE DATABASE WHATEVER  
AUTOMATIC STORAGE YES
ON /data DBPATH ON /log;
UPDATE DB CFG WHATEVER USING newlogpath /log;

要麼

CREATE DATABASE WHATEVER  
AUTOMATIC STORAGE YES
ON /data DBPATH ON /data;
UPDATE DB CFG WHATEVER USING newlogpath /log;

前幾天我注意到一個系統同時使用 /data 作為 DBPATH 和表空間儲存,我想知道 /log 是否會成為 DBPATH 的更好選擇?

有什麼想法嗎?

幾乎可以肯定這並不重要。

訪問數據庫路徑中文件的唯一重要 I/O 將是恢復歷史文件(即使這並不多)。

考慮到如果您不指定 DB2 預設使用第一個儲存路徑,那麼如果這是唯一的選擇DBPATH ON,我會使用它。/data

我的 SOP 是將 DBPATH 保留在實例所有者的主目錄中。這顯然是另一個重要的位置,也許比其他兩個位置更有意義。

引用自:https://dba.stackexchange.com/questions/149382